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:25 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 medium, diced onion
  • 2 cloves, minced garlic
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 0.5 teaspoon paprika
  • 0.5 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 0.5 medium, diced red bell pepper
  • 2 tablespoons, chopped fresh parsley

Directions

Step 1

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Step 2

Add the diced onion and cook until it becomes translucent, about 3-4 minutes.

Step 3

Stir in the minced gar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ute.

Step 4

Add the ground beef to the skillet. Break it apart with a wooden spoon and cook until browned, about 5-7 minutes.

Step 5

Drain any excess grease from the skillet, if necessary.

Step 6

Sprinkle black pepper, paprika, and dried thyme over the browned beef. Stir well to combine.

Step 7

Add the diced red bell pepper and continue to cook for another 2-3 minutes until the peppers are tender but not mushy.

Step 8

Remove the skillet from heat and stir in the chopped fresh parsley.

Step 9

Serve as desired, using as a filling for tacos, a topping for salads, or in a low-sodium pasta dish.
